  "summary": "At a time when fashion is increasingly dominated by mass production, a young Kenyan designer is taking a slower approach. Hillary Mukabwa, the founder and lead designer of Mukabwa Studio in Nairobi, works with hand looms to create cotton fabrics that he turns into clothes, bags and more in a deliberate attempt to reconnect with a craft increasingly being pushed aside by modernisation.",
